Cornmeal batter according to any good receipe, preferably yellow. Melt lard or Crisco to about 1/4" deep in a cast iron frying pan until bubbling, pour in batter bake until golden brown serve hot with plenty of real butter and blackberry jam. Follow with cold glass of milk.
